Shark Reef – Fantastic Dive! …. pictures
So a group of advanced divers headed out with the plan for Hema 1 and Shark Reef. Well, the Hema 1 was a miss with strong currents we crawled along the bottom long enough to know we were close but not making it then did a long blue water ascent. But, shark reef was in fine form to make up for whatever we might have missed. Started with a free swimming nurse shark pup, followed by lobster clusters, spider crabs, a big nurse shark, southern sting rays and a friendly Hawksbill turtle. We were under until the air ran out and came up a very happy bunch of divers!
